Church of Christ Church, Grade II listed church in Cambridge, England
Church of Christ Church is a Grade II listed church building in Cambridge featuring traditional Anglican architectural elements including stone walls, pointed arches, and stained glass windows. The structure spans multiple sections and displays the characteristic building style typical of the region.
The building was constructed during a period of religious expansion in Cambridge and later received Grade II listed status in recognition of its architectural and historical significance. This classification reflects its importance in the development of the city's religious structures.
The church serves as a place for regular Anglican worship and functions as a gathering space where the local community comes together for religious ceremonies and events.
